Thanks: Gave 0, Got 1 | Finally got our Hitachi on the wall, see what you think
We bought the PD7200 last year and am still very very pleased with it. We'd always planned to mount it on the chimney breast however, running the wires up the chimney.
We took out the fire place as it was never used and have modded the hole to fit the AV equipment in.
After finally getting it done, I hope other plasma wall mounters may be able to get some ideas from how we managed ours. See what you think  (Big thanks to my girlfriends dad who designed and built everything!)
